From 89027579bc6c2febbcc9c2f9d5069adf71539e4b Mon Sep 17 00:00:00 2001
From: Herbert Xu <herbert@gondor.apana.org.au>
Date: Sun, 26 Feb 2017 12:24:10 +0800
Subject: [PATCH 06/12] crypto: xts - Propagate NEED_FALLBACK bit

When we're used as a fallback algorithm, we should propagate
the NEED_FALLBACK bit when searching for the underlying ECB mode.

This just happens to fix a hang too because otherwise the search
may end up loading the same module that triggered this XTS creation.

From 3b30460c5b0ed762be75a004e924ec3f8711e032 Mon Sep 17 00:00:00 2001
From: Ard Biesheuvel <ard.biesheuvel@linaro.org>
Date: Mon, 27 Feb 2017 15:30:56 +0000
Subject: [PATCH 07/12] crypto: ccm - move cbcmac input off the stack

Commit f15f05b0a5de ("crypto: ccm - switch to separate cbcmac driver")
refactored the CCM driver to allow separate implementations of the
underlying MAC to be provided by a platform. However, in doing so, it
moved some data from the linear region to the stack, which violates the
SG constraints when the stack is virtually mapped.

So move idata/odata back to the request ctx struct, of which we can
reasonably expect that it has been allocated using kmalloc() et al.

From efa7cebdbfde8506b54acd8947822394768cd476 Mon Sep 17 00:00:00 2001
From: Ard Biesheuvel <ard.biesheuvel@linaro.org>
Date: Tue, 28 Feb 2017 14:36:57 +0000
Subject: [PATCH 09/12] crypto: arm/crc32 - add build time test for CRC
 instruction support

The accelerated CRC32 module for ARM may use either the scalar CRC32
instructions, the NEON 64x64 to 128 bit polynomial multiplication
(vmull.p64) instruction, or both, depending on what the current CPU
supports.

However, this also requires support in binutils, and as it turns out,
versions of binutils exist that support the vmull.p64 instruction but
not the crc32 instructions.

So refactor the Makefile logic so that this module only gets built if
binutils has support for both.

This always happens on the same IV which is less than 16 bytes.

Per Ard,

"CCM IVs are 16 bytes, but due to the way they are constructed
internally, the final couple of bytes of input IV are dont-cares.

Apparently, we do read all 16 bytes, which triggers the KASAN errors."

Fix this by padding the IV with null bytes to be at least 16 bytes.
